Struct DynamicStreams 

Source
pub struct DynamicStreams<InstrumentKey> {
    pub trades: VecMap<ExchangeId, UnboundedReceiverStream<MarketStreamResult<InstrumentKey, PublicTrade>>>,
    pub l1s: VecMap<ExchangeId, UnboundedReceiverStream<MarketStreamResult<InstrumentKey, OrderBookL1>>>,
    pub l2s: VecMap<ExchangeId, UnboundedReceiverStream<MarketStreamResult<InstrumentKey, OrderBookEvent>>>,
    pub liquidations: VecMap<ExchangeId, UnboundedReceiverStream<MarketStreamResult<InstrumentKey, Liquidation>>>,
    pub candles: VecMap<ExchangeId, UnboundedReceiverStream<MarketStreamResult<InstrumentKey, Candle>>>,
}

impl<InstrumentKey> DynamicStreams<InstrumentKey>

Source

pub async fn init<SubBatchIter, SubIter, Sub, Instrument>( subscription_batches: SubBatchIter, ) -> Result<Self, DataError>
where SubBatchIter: IntoIterator<Item = SubIter>, SubIter: IntoIterator<Item = Sub>, Sub: Into<Subscription<ExchangeId, Instrument, SubKind>>, Instrument: InstrumentData<Key = InstrumentKey> + Ord + Display + 'static, InstrumentKey: Debug + Clone + PartialEq + Send + Sync + 'static, Subscription<BinanceSpot, Instrument, PublicTrades>: Identifier<BinanceMarket>, Subscription<BinanceSpot, Instrument, OrderBooksL1>: Identifier<BinanceMarket>, Subscription<BinanceSpot, Instrument, OrderBooksL2>: Identifier<BinanceMarket>, Subscription<BinanceFuturesUsd, Instrument, PublicTrades>: Identifier<BinanceMarket>, Subscription<BinanceFuturesUsd, Instrument, OrderBooksL1>: Identifier<BinanceMarket>, Subscription<BinanceFuturesUsd, Instrument, OrderBooksL2>: Identifier<BinanceMarket>, Subscription<BinanceFuturesUsdMarket, Instrument, Liquidations>: Identifier<BinanceMarket>, Subscription<BinanceSpot, Instrument, Candles>: Identifier<BinanceMarket>, Subscription<BinanceFuturesUsdMarket, Instrument, Candles>: Identifier<BinanceMarket>, Subscription<Bitfinex, Instrument, PublicTrades>: Identifier<BitfinexMarket>, Subscription<Bitmex, Instrument, PublicTrades>: Identifier<BitmexMarket>, Subscription<BybitSpot, Instrument, PublicTrades>: Identifier<BybitMarket>, Subscription<BybitSpot, Instrument, OrderBooksL1>: Identifier<BybitMarket>, Subscription<BybitSpot, Instrument, OrderBooksL2>: Identifier<BybitMarket>, Subscription<BybitPerpetualsUsd, Instrument, PublicTrades>: Identifier<BybitMarket>, Subscription<BybitPerpetualsUsd, Instrument, OrderBooksL1>: Identifier<BybitMarket>, Subscription<BybitPerpetualsUsd, Instrument, OrderBooksL2>: Identifier<BybitMarket>, Subscription<Coinbase, Instrument, PublicTrades>: Identifier<CoinbaseMarket>, Subscription<GateioSpot, Instrument, PublicTrades>: Identifier<GateioMarket>, Subscription<GateioFuturesUsd, Instrument, PublicTrades>: Identifier<GateioMarket>, Subscription<GateioFuturesBtc, Instrument, PublicTrades>: Identifier<GateioMarket>, Subscription<GateioPerpetualsUsd, Instrument, PublicTrades>: Identifier<GateioMarket>, Subscription<GateioPerpetualsBtc, Instrument, PublicTrades>: Identifier<GateioMarket>, Subscription<GateioOptions, Instrument, PublicTrades>: Identifier<GateioMarket>, Subscription<Kraken, Instrument, PublicTrades>: Identifier<KrakenMarket>, Subscription<Kraken, Instrument, OrderBooksL1>: Identifier<KrakenMarket>, Subscription<Okx, Instrument, PublicTrades>: Identifier<OkxMarket>,

Initialise a set of Streams by providing one or more Subscription batches.

Each batch (ie/ impl Iterator<Item = Subscription>) will initialise at-least-one WebSocket Stream under the hood. If the batch contains more-than-one ExchangeId and/or SubKind, it will be further split under the hood for compile-time reasons.

pub fn select_candles( &mut self, exchange: ExchangeId, ) -> Option<UnboundedReceiverStream<MarketStreamResult<InstrumentKey, Candle>>>

Remove an exchange Candle Stream from the DynamicStreams collection.

Note that calling this method will permanently remove this Stream from Self.

§Mixed intervals

DynamicStreams keys candle streams by ExchangeId only, so subscribing to multiple intervals on one exchange (e.g. Candles { Min1 } + Candles { Hour1 } on BinanceSpot) merges them into this single per-exchange stream. Each distinct interval is a separate upstream WebSocket subscription (mind venue per-connection stream limits at high symbol × interval fan-out). Because Candle carries no interval field, a consumer mixing intervals must recover it from close_time spacing or the originating subscription; if per-interval routing matters, use the typed Streams builder with one StreamSelector per interval.

pub fn select_all_candles( &mut self, ) -> SelectAll<UnboundedReceiverStream<MarketStreamResult<InstrumentKey, Candle>>>

Select and merge every exchange Candle Stream using SelectAll.

See select_candles for how multiple intervals on one exchange are merged — the merged Candles carry no interval to disambiguate them.
